The Glebe House is an impeccable example of the beautiful, symmetrical Georgian architecture found along the East Lothian coastline. The property is approached via a private driveway, offering a first glimpse of the striking red sandstone building before opening into a gravel parking area at the front. The main three storey house is elegantly framed by two ground level wings and an additional orangery.

Entering through an impressive front door beneath an ornate fanlight, the entrance hall features tiled flooring and detailed decorative cornicing and plasterwork, elements that are echoed throughout the property. Stairs rise to the first floor landing, while a hall straight ahead leads to the main reception rooms.

The impressive drawing room lies to the rear of the house, enjoying views towards the sea. The room retains many of its original features, including a curved wall, open fireplace, and ornate cornicing. The dining room provides ample space for entertaining and is a bright, generous room illuminated by large windows overlooking the town below. Completing the accommodation accessed from the main hall are a cosy snug with views over the front lawn, and two double bedrooms, both served by a bathroom.

To the right of the entrance hall is access to both the dining room and the kitchen. The kitchen is a warm and inviting space, featuring base units, a four door green AGA, and tiled flooring. A useful utility room is located to the rear, alongside a pantry. A boot room and WC are also accessed from the kitchen. The kitchen opens into a bright orangery that seamlessly blends the stunning garden views with the interior. Patio doors lead out to the east side of the garden. A study lies adjacent to the garden room and also provides external access.

On the first floor, the principal bedroom is positioned to the right of the landing, with views over the coastline. This generously proportioned room features a walk in wardrobe and an en suite bathroom. Two further bedrooms are located on this floor, one of which also benefits from an en suite shower room. A family bathroom and a separate WC complete the accommodation on this level. Stairs lead to the attic, where a double bedroom and a single bedroom are found. A store room provides access to a floored section of the remaining attic space.

The gardens surrounding The Glebe House lie mainly to the south and are given privacy by a screen of mature trees. Box hedging borders a colourful flowerbed in front of the house, and there is a large patio beside the orangery, ideal for outdoor dining and entertaining. The east garden is more formal and features box hedging, rose beds, and flowering plants that provide year round colour. One of the more unusual features of this centrally located home is the Glebe Field, which extends to around 1.7 acres and has been used for grazing.
